Web2 days ago · Ontario’s programs have long been understaffed. According to a study commissioned by the Invasive Species Centre in 2024, the economic impacts across all of Ontario’s sectors is estimated to be $3.6 billion per year. Yet the provincial government invests only $4 million annually in invasive species programs. WebDec 8, 2015 · Apis mellifera is actually an invader from the Old World: having buzzed from Africa to Europe, it was brought to America by colonists and went wild. Invasive plants provide food and nests for vulnerable natives; invasive animals can help native species by killing their predators, as the poisonous cane toad has done in Australia.
